13011222317 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 13011222318. Its totient is φ = 13011222316.

The previous prime is 13011222293. The next prime is 13011222349. The reversal of 13011222317 is 71322211031.

It is a weak pr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 9550371076 + 3460851241 = 97726^2 + 58829^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 13011222317 - 218 = 13010960173 is a prime.

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 13011222292 and 13011222301.

It is a congruent number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(13011222377)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 6505611158 + 6505611159.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(6505611159).

Almost surely, 213011222317 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

13011222317 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

13011222317 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

13011222317 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 504, while the sum is 23.

Adding to 13011222317 its reverse (71322211031), we get a palindrome (84333433348).

The spelling of 13011222317 in words is "thirteen billion, eleven million, two hundred twenty-two thousand, three hundred seventeen".
